It's finally 2014, and for a lot of us, that means fresh starts and new beginnings. Making resolutions is a great way to set goals, but for me, my resolutions don't last much past february...

So I've decided to give you guys some tips to help you to finally acheive those resolutions and make 2014 your best year yet!

1. Be specific. 

A resolution like "Eat healthier" is great, but something like "Eat more vegetables" or "Drink more water" is even better.

2. Divide your big goals into smaller goals.

Sometimes when you give yourself a big goal like to "Exercise every day", it can be slightly overwhelming. Try to start with 3 days a week, and then gradually increase, or you could exercise for 10 minutes a day and work up to an hour a day.

3. Have friends support you.

Use peer pressure to your advantage. Have your friends check up on you and see how you are doing on your goals throughout the year and you will stay motivated until next December (:
